Verdict
A small turnout for this valuable handicap but it is still very competitive, Alshawmeq and Maclean hold very strong claims, but we will side with Tableau. This son of Marquetry had shaped quite well on his seasonal bow at Doncaster at March and despite the long holiday, put up a very good front running performance to beat some decent types at Leicester last time. There is scope for further improvement and he could improve past these more exposed types. Alshawameq finished fifth in what looked a stronger event over course and distance last time and should go close despite top-weight of nine stone seven. Maclean appeared not to stay the ten furlongs at Salisbury last time and is better judged on his previous third over course and distance. Momtic and Hazewind come here in good heart and should also take a hand in the finish, but in what is a very tricky contest Tableau may just have the edge.
